Espresso README

Espresso: The-M-Projects build tools using node.js

Installation

Prerequesites

To install espresso you need Node.js >= 0.4 and either git or npm.

Install via git

Check out the project with git, init the submodules and create an alias. Step-by-step presuming you have a ~/Code

  1. Install node.js. see description here

  2. cd into Code folder

    cd ~/Code/

  3. Checkout Espresso:

    git clone https://github.com/wherewolfNZ/Espresso.git

  4. Initialize submodules:

    git submodule update --init

  5. Install NPM modules

    npm install

  6. Create an alias:

    alias espresso='~/Code/Espresso/bin/espresso.js'

Usage

  1. Create a new HelloWorld project:

    espresso init --project HelloWorld --example

  2. Build it:

    cd HelloWorld && espresso build

  3. Run the development server:

    espresso server

  4. Generate new files

    espresso generate -c testcontroller -v testview -m testmodel

This command will generate a new model, a new view and a new controller.
